As we all know, colors play an important role in our lives. They have the ability to affect our moods, emotions and thoughts. In Feng Shui, the use of colors is based on the five elements theory. The theory states that there are five elements in the universe – wood, fire, earth, metal and water. Each element is associated with a certain color.

Here is a brief overview of the colors and their corresponding elements:

Wood – green
Fire – red
Earth – yellow
Metal – white
Water – black

When it comes to using colors in Feng Shui, it is important to consider the direction of the space as well as the individual’s personal goals and aspirations.



For example, if you are looking to create a more calming and relaxing environment, you would use colors that are associated with the earth element such as yellow and beige. If you are looking to create a more energetic and vibrant environment, you would use colors that are associated with the fire element such as red and orange.

Here are some general tips for using colors in Feng Shui:

• Use light colors to create a calming and relaxing environment.
• Use dark colors to create a more formal and sophisticated environment.
• Use bright colors to create a more energetic and vibrant environment.
